RoboticsAdvancedArchived2014-2016

Wireless Robot Control v1.0

★ Embedded-to-desktop control with vision.
Problem

Remotely drive/monitor a multi-motor robot with obstacle awareness and visual tracking.

System approach

Firmware fuses 4 sonars + Pixy vision (SPI) + motor current/temp into a framed serial protocol; C# desktop app.

Architecture
Arduino Mega NewPing x4 Pixy vision SPI C#/.NET custom serial protocol
Results
  • 4-direction ultrasonic sensing
  • Pixy object tracking over SPI
  • Current+temp telemetry
  • C# GUI; 3 firmware iterations
Stack
ArduinoEmbedded CPixyC#/.NET
Evidence level
Source code

Appears in career timeline

View timeline →